Output 57e2b0dbce37965955a66437fdf39dc17e7c7c4949019dfd6018d3a1fd04a94a:5

value
16021491
script pubkey
OP_0 OP_PUSHBYTES_20 80fe9ba03f470f1c267dbf4111784c27c7d8c8a6
address
ltc1qsrlfhgplgu83cfnahaq3z7zvylra3j9xj4ucnj
transaction
57e2b0dbce37965955a66437fdf39dc17e7c7c4949019dfd6018d3a1fd04a94a
spent
true